06901 vs 06903 — Compare ZIP Codes

Side-by-side comparison. Blue = ZIP 06901, Orange = ZIP 06903.

Quick verdict: ZIP 06901 is more affordable rent, lower unemployment, more diverse. ZIP 06903 is wealthier, higher home values, lower poverty rate, more educated, higher work-from-home share.
